diff options
author | James Almer <jamrial@gmail.com> | 2022-03-18 09:46:09 -0300 |
---|---|---|
committer | James Almer <jamrial@gmail.com> | 2022-03-29 16:34:56 -0300 |
commit | 7c35aa60a5131b129cf474ae7f27f949a26ae21c (patch) | |
tree | 609177d8ba93f932476fc8ea4cc60dbe8fdeb165 /libavformat/gif.c | |
parent | 96ebf7dceba882134911df6651cee49c70511c37 (diff) | |
download | ffmpeg-7c35aa60a5131b129cf474ae7f27f949a26ae21c.tar.gz |
avcodec/wmalosslessdec: ensure channel count in the private context and decoder context are consistent
Fixes: Out of array write
Fixes: 45613/clusterfuzz-testcase-minimized-ffmpeg_AV_CODEC_ID_WMALOSSLESS_fuzzer-4539073606320128
Fixes: 46008/clusterfuzz-testcase-minimized-ffmpeg_AV_CODEC_ID_WMALOSSLESS_fuzzer-4681245747970048
Found-by: continuous fuzzing process https://github.com/google/oss-fuzz/tree/master/projects/ffmpeg
Reviewed-by: Michael Niedermayer <michael@niedermayer.cc>
Signed-off-by: James Almer <jamrial@gmail.com>
Diffstat (limited to 'libavformat/gif.c')
0 files changed, 0 insertions, 0 deletions